新手编写PLC程序常见错误类型 (新手编写plc程序遇到的问题)

新手编写PLC程序常见错误类型及其解决方案 新手编写plc程序遇到的问题

摘要:
本文旨在帮助新手了解在编写PLC(可编程逻辑控制器)程序时常见的错误类型及相应的解决方法。PLC作为工业控制的核心组成部分,广泛应用于各种自动化设备中。对于初学者来说,掌握常见的错误类型和预防措施是非常重要的。本文将介绍一些常见的PLC编程错误,并提供相应的解决方案和建议,以帮助新手避免这些错误,提高编程技能。

一、引入

随着自动化技术的快速发展,PLC在工业生产中的应用越来越广泛。
对于初学者来说,编写PLC程序可能会遇到各种问题和挑战。
本文总结了新手在编写PLC程序时常见的错误类型,帮助新手了解和解决这些问题,提高编程水平。

二、常见错误类型

1. 语法错误

语法错误是PLC编程中最常见的错误之一。
由于PLC编程语言的特殊性,语法规则较为严格,新手在编写程序时往往容易忽略某些,如关键字使用不当、括号不匹配等。
这些错误虽然看似简单,但会导致程序无法正常运行。

2. 逻辑错误

逻辑错误是PLC编程中的另一种常见错误。
由于PLC程序需要根据实际需求进行逻辑设计,新手在理解需求和设计逻辑时容易出现偏差,导致程序无法实现预期功能。

3. 注释不足

良好的注释习惯对于PLC程序的维护和调试非常重要。
新手在编写PLC程序时往往忽略注释的重要性,导致程序难以理解和维护。

4. 变量命名不规范

在PLC编程中,变量的命名应该具有描述性和规范性。
新手在命名变量时往往随意命名,导致变量名含义不明确,给程序调试和维护带来困难。

5. 未考虑异常情况

PLC程序需要处理各种异常情况,如输入信号丢失、传感器故障等。
新手在编写程序时往往忽略异常情况的处理,导致程序在实际运行中出现问题。

三、解决方案和建议

1. 加强语法学习

为了避免语法错误,新手需要加强PLC编程语言的学习,特别是语法规则的学习。
在编写程序时,要注意,反复检查语法是否正确。

2. 提高逻辑思维能力

为了避免逻辑错误,新手需要提高逻辑思维能力。
在设计PLC程序时,要充分了解实际需求,理清思路,设计合理的逻辑结构。

3. 养成良好注释习惯

为了方便程序的维护和调试,新手在编写PLC程序时要养成良好的注释习惯。
对关键代码段进行注释,说明代码的功能和实现方法。

4. 规范变量命名

为了避免变量命名不规范的问题,新手需要了解变量命名的规范和要求。
在命名变量时,要使用有意义的名称,避免使用缩写和含糊的名称。

5. 考虑异常情况

在处理PLC程序的异常情况时,新手需要充分了解实际运行环境,考虑可能出现的异常情况,并在程序中进行相应的处理。
例如,对于输入信号丢失的情况,可以设置默认值或进行提示。

四、总结

本文总结了新手在编写PLC程序时常见的错误类型,包括语法错误、逻辑错误、注释不足、变量命名不规范以及未考虑异常情况等。
针对这些错误类型,本文提供了相应的解决方案和建议,包括加强语法学习、提高逻辑思维能力、养成良好注释习惯、规范变量命名以及考虑异常情况等。
希望本文能帮助新手避免这些常见错误,提高PLC编程技能。


对PLC有编程经验的网友,请教几个问题,我完全是个新手

1、不同厂家的PLC,都有自己专用的编程软件,如日本OMRON的CX-ONE; 德国西门子的STEP-7美国AB的RXLOGIX通过这些软件,可以方便的编写梯形图程序。 编好的梯形图可以下载到PLC内存中,下载过程是由软件自动完成的,不需要你去转换代码。 2、顺序图反映了执行机构动作的时序,这不是梯形图,需要你根据时序图进行编程。 3、做一个项目编程之前,当然要先做“控制流程图”,这是程序的执行整体框架,让编程人员知道编程的目的、要求,但不能利用软件自动转换为梯形图,需要你根据这个控制流程框架,自己去编写PLC梯形图。

PLC正常运行的程序突然之间运算错误?

针对PLC运算错误的问题,您可以依据以下步骤来进行排查:

plc程序读取出来全是m开头看不到x或者y

具体有以下原因:1、变量名错误:请确保您的变量名以字母开头,而不是数字。 如果变量名以数字开头,则可能会导致PLC无法正确识别它们。 2、数据类型错误:请确保您的变量的数据类型与实际数据类型匹配。 例如,如果您尝试将一个字符串类型的值存储在一个整数类型的变量中,那么PLC可能无法正确解析该值。 3、程序逻辑错误:请检查您的程序逻辑是否正确。 如果您的程序中有语法错误、逻辑错误或其他问题,那么PLC可能无法正确执行您的指令。 如果您无法确定问题所在,可以尝试使用调试工具来帮助您找到问题。 例如,您可以在PLC上启用调试模式,并逐步执行程序以查看每个步骤的结果。 这可以帮助您确定程序中的错误并进行修复。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论